How much do solar oper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for solar operations manager in Florida is $47,420.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$30,600.00 and $57,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some typical challenges a solar operations manager faces when overseeing multiple solar sites?

A Solar Operations Manager often contends with challenges such as coordinating maintenance schedules across geographically dispersed sites, managing real-time performance data, and responding promptly to system outages or technical issues. Balancing the demands of regulatory compliance, safety protocols, and cost efficiency is also crucial. To address these challenges, strong communication with technicians, clear documentation practices, and effective use of monitoring software are essential. Collaboration with engineering teams and external service providers further supports smooth operations and minimizes downtime.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a solar operations manager?

A Solar Operations Manager needs expertise in solar energy systems, operations management, and a relevant engineering or technical degree. Familiarity with SCADA systems, maintenance management software, and industry certifications like NABCEP is often required.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ills are essential for managing teams and coordinating with stakeholders. These skills ensure efficient plant performance, safety compliance, and the successful delivery of renewable energy projects.

What does a solar operations manager do?

A Solar Operations Manager oversees the daily operations and maintenance of solar energy facilities to ensure optimal performance and efficiency. Their responsibilities include monitoring system output, managing maintenance teams, ensuring compliance with safety and regulatory standards, and coordinating repairs or upgrades as needed. They also analyze performance data, prepare reports for stakeholders, and work to minimize downtime while maximizing the energy output of solar installations. This role requires a strong understanding of solar technology, project management skills, and the ability to troubleshoot technical issues quickly.

What is the difference between Solar Operations Manager vs Solar Project Engineer?

AspectSolar Operations ManagerSolar Project Engineer
CredentialsRelevant certifications (e.g., NABCEP), experience in operationsEngineering degree, technical certifications
Work EnvironmentOversees daily operations, maintenance, and team managementDesign, planning, and technical analysis of solar projects
Employer & Industry UsageUtility companies, solar firms, project developersEngineering firms, project developers, EPC contractors
Search & Comparison IntentOperational roles, team management, maintenanceDesign, technical planning, project development

The Solar Operations Manager focuses on overseeing daily operations, maintenance, and team management within solar projects, ensuring smooth functioning. In contrast, the Solar Project Engineer concentrates on designing, planning, and technical aspects of solar projects during development. Both roles are essential in the solar industry but serve different functions related to project lifecycle stages.

A quick summary about the Client Service Specialist role:
As a Client Services Specialist, you will provide legendary customer service to Orlando Solar Bears season ticket holders, group buyers, the general ticket-buying public and all game day fans. Exceed expectations by acting as a proactive point of contact for all season ticket holders and group leaders. Assist with developing a long-term fan retention and growth strategy to reach or exceed annual stated season ticket holder and group renewal goals.
What the role will do:
Account Management & Retention
  • Serve as a single point of contact within the Orlando Solar Bears for 300+ season ticket members by answering questions and performing duties related to account service and retention.
  • Manage all elements of the automatic renewal process and renew 300+ season ticket member accounts annually.
  • Foster and maintain positive relationships with client base through the execution of proactive and reactive client touchpoints including outbound phone calls, strategic email communications, and weekly in-game and out of office appointments.
  • Utilize all provided data and analytics on season ticket holders to proactively manage behaviors that drive long term retention.
  • Encourage adoption and utilization of the Orlando Solar Bears app as an added value benefit to STM's, and engage accounts with exclusive app opportunities that create long term affinity and retention.
  • Effectively utilize CRM to achieve account touchpoint goals, including but not limited to the creation of account lists, ad-hoc account analyses, and strategic management of client base, cases/opportunities, and legendary moments associated to accounts.
  • Execute legendary moments, including but not limited to post-game press conferences, anthem buddies, high-five fan squad and honorary captain, throughout each season to positively impact clients' experience as an Orlando Solar Bears season ticket member.
  • Assist with the execution of all season ticket member events, first year orientation, open practices, and milestone gift distribution.
  • Achieve additional revenue generation goals throughout the year via full and partial plan season ticket sales and group sales.
  • In conjunction with Ticket Operations, manage the collection of all account payments, ensure timely payments, and establish action plans for delinquent accounts.
  • Work with Account Representatives in executing large group sales event logistics.
  • Assist in the management of scheduling Group Sales fan experiences for both the Ticket Sales Department and other applicable internal departments.
  • Organize and track spreadsheets for RSVPs to sales events.
  • Assistance with season ticket and partial plan delinquent account communication and tracking
  • Ensure that game night sales activations, such as sales kiosks, are adequately equipped with relevant collateral and sales support materials.

General
  • Work all Solar Bears home games and assist part-time staff at the Amway Center Guest Assistance booths on the concourse as needed.
  • Work with staff to develop and execute improvements to the game day experience for all fans.
  • All other duties as assigned.
What the role needs to have:
  • Bachelor's degree preferred or equivalent work experience required.
  • Minimum of two years of customer service-related work experience required.
  • Archtics and CRM experience strongly preferred.
  • Sales experience strongly preferred.
  • Ability to work all Solar Bears home games plus a select number of non-game events. This includes the ability to work a flexible schedule including nights and weekends and be on-call as necessary based on the changing priorities of the department.
  • Proficient in all Microsoft Office products and other related computer skills required.
